Many companies are using AI and automation to pre-screen candidate applications and minimize the workload for overtaxed HR professionals. It’s estimated that over 99% of Fortune 500 companies use an Automated Tracking System (ATS) to screen candidates, and smaller organizations are starting to follow suit.

Discrimination disregards performance. Plaintiffs in Nike’s pending equal pay lawsuit allege women were paid less despite “the same or better performance ratings, educational background, and work experience”. A Pew Research study into DEI at work supports those findings. Wage disparities grow even greater as women are promoted.
